Moisture was entering a crawlspace in Bismarck, MO causing condensation to form on the air vents and make the crawlspace humid. To solve this issue, the CleanSpace crawlspace encapsulation system was installed. This liner completely isolates the crawlspace from the earth. This dramatically reduces the humidity level in the air, which will eliminate mold growth and rot from the crawlspace and make the whole house healthier. The bright white finished side will brighten the crawlspace and allows one to easily see that the crawlspace is free of mold, insects, and dirt. This crawlspace will remain clean and dry for years to come!

David W. of Swansea, IL was looking to waterproof and insulate his crawl space. Our system design specialist, John S., recommended a SmartSump, SmartSump and CleanSpace Vapor Barrier for waterproofing purposes. The CleanSpace lines the crawl space and keeps out moisture, where the SmartSump and SmartPipe work to redirect and pump water out of the crawl space. Our foreman Jose L. and his crew installed these systems, along with a SilverGlo Wall Insulation System. SilverGlo keeps the crawl space and floors above warmer, yet dry, in the winter, saving David money on energy and heating bills.
